WATCH LIVE | FRONTLINE: News24 panel unpacks Stellenbosch University's secret shame
At 12:30, on Thursday, 1 February, News24 editor-in-chief Adriaan Basson will host a virtual panel to discuss the Wilgenhof brotherhood and the veil of secrecy that allowed the apparent abuse of students to remain in the shadows for decades. Basson will be joined by constitutional law expert Pierre de Vos, gender activist Laurie Gaum - both Wilgenhof alumni - as well as SU's senior director of student affairs, Dr Choice Makhetha. #News24Video For this story and more, visit News24: https://www.news24.com/
